Default Capital Tropical - Two Man Sound (7:24)

on one disc. For lovers of hi-nrg dance music of the 80s. Track times:

1. capital tropical (7:24)
2. so many men (7:28)
3. searchin (8:27)
4. coming out of hiding (6:10)
5. color my love (7:37)
6. high energy (7:50)
7. seclusion (7:32)
8. don quichotte (6:29)
9. wake up (3:23)
10. the roof is on fire (4:01)
11. weekend (5:13)
This album contains my favorite songs of the early 80's "post-disco" era...The songs are in their full 12" format...songs you can't find anywhere else on CD!!! The CD is worth it just for Pamala Stanley's "Coming Out of Hiding" a rare gem found here in 12" version. These are my favourite 12" singles..."So Many Men, So Little Time", "High Energy", "Colour My Love"...HOT dance songs from end to end....perfect for dancing, exercising...Beautiful sound, beautiful tracks...
